作者Rday (R天)
看板Office
標題[問題] excel 觸發事件
時間Wed Feb 24 07:02:13 2021
我有一個程式是把收集好的資料
編輯好後另開新工作簿貼上去
可是程式內建會複製過去
新開的工作簿沒有workbook.beforesave的觸發事件
該怎麼讓新開的工作簿也能觸發呢?
--
※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 114.137.53.73 (臺灣)
※ 文章網址: https://webptt.com/m.aspx?n=bbs/Office/M.1614121335.A.97B.html
1F:→ soyoso: 這方面可以vbproject.vbcomponents來新增, 02/24 07:56
2F:→ soyoso: createeventproc 02/24 07:56
3F:→ soyoso: 或是以codemodule也可以 02/24 08:07
4F:→ Rday: 不好意思,我是新手,要如何新增呢? 02/24 08:55
5F:→ soyoso: ..vbcomponents.codemodule的方式,以insertlines,新增觸 02/24 09:13
6F:→ soyoso: 發事件createeventproc或以字串,二種測試是可行的,可以 02/24 09:13
7F:→ soyoso: 回文的方式google一下,會有範例 02/24 09:13